    <title>Service Tax – Notification 17/2002 ST Dated 21.11.2002- Exemption to services rendered to a developer or init of Special Economic Zones –Notifying the procedures therefore- Regarding</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/circulars?id=53666</link>
    <description>A procedural regime is prescribed for claiming the service tax exemption for services to SEZ developers or units: a committee chaired by the Chief Commissioner will examine applications; applicants must file the prescribed form with the Development Commissioner, who certifies and forwards it to the Commissioner of Central Excise, Kolkata VII for verification and onward transmission to the Chief Commissioner. Timelines of ten days are set at each stage. If approved, the Chief Commissioner issues a certificate to be supplied to service providers and referenced on invoices; certificates expire at the end of the financial year and require annual renewal.</description>
